Why Your Business Needs Native Integration

Seamless native integration is the key to scaling your business in the long term. Integration can come in many forms, but native integrations allow for more customization. Thus, they are better prepared to help your business thrive. 

With as much as a third of spending amongst information technology (IT) professionals going towards cloud services, there’s no argument that businesses are looking for easy solutions to their problems. 

Admittedly third-party connectors for data integration can accomplish many goals for your business. But is it the best way to get what you really want?

To learn more about what native integration can bring to the table for you and your business, stay tuned!

What Is Native Integration?

Native integration refers to a means of integrating software applications or platforms with one another using application programming interfaces (APIs)

The importance of native integration lies behind the idea of communication. Suffice to say, nobody would disagree that communication is important. 

Yet it is sometimes hard to fathom that technology places the same importance on communication. 

This is why APIs are integral to the concept of native integration. To elaborate, APIs are back-end structures of code that ensure that distinct software systems can interact

API integrations define the connections that occur between systems via the proper implementation of APIs. 

Native integration is a particular mode of integration that utilizes APIs. Unlike non-native integrations, native integrations work with the native features and internal mapping of the current technical infrastructure of your business. 

The native aspect of native integrations is paramount, as not every integration app can promise seamless integration with your business systems. And other approaches to integration opt for a one-size-fits-all solution. 

Via native integrations and integration as a whole, businesses gain premier access to marketing automation tools, content management systems, management software platforms, and really any and all connections that could be expressly useful. 

Native Integration vs. Third-Party Data Integration

Data integration, in general, is a crucial part of maintaining the digital livelihood of your business. In the modern-day, businesses run on tech. 

This is the consequence of the never-ending digital transformation that has changed the way businesses do business for good. 

But this isn’t exactly a bad thing. Cyber-centric ventures like the adoption of cloud technology and marketing automation have only optimized business in the long run. 

Businesses use software to organize marketing activities, navigate sales, manage leads, and do much much more. 

With all that said, it should come as no surprise that businesses use multiple software systems to get the job done, each and every day. 

Data integration involves syncing business systems together for more efficient management.

data-sync-integration.jpg
Data integration syncs business systems together under one platform. 

There are many data integration tools, many of which are software as a service (SaaS) cloud solutions that are easy to find and use. 

But while native integration relies on custom APIs, traditional data integration platforms depend on third-party connectors that do not have a comprehensive understanding of your business systems

Unfortunately, this understanding, so to speak, requires a deep analysis and special attention to your business ecosystem that not all business-to-business (B2B) models are prepared to offer. 

In other words, such a model needs custom software development. However, what some experts call the ‘consumerization of enterprise’ has yielded thousands of cookie-cutter B2B software platforms with little patience to tackle your specific business needs. 

In fact, integration platform as a service (iPaaS) has emerged as its own category for classifying cloud integration business models. 

The benefit of iPaaS solutions is that they standardize the integration process. The drawback is that they’re limited in scope and customizability. 

Needless to say, this is why native integration can be a desirable asset for scaling businesses. 

Advantages of Native Integration

By now, the reasons to employ native integration likely seem obvious. But just in case you need some more convincing, take a look at some of these advantages. 

Customizability 

Customization, as a rule, is the main advantage of native integration. Non-native solutions come with limitations. They are not equipped to deal with edge cases that do not fit the classic mold. 

This is because blanket software connectors do not know the intricacies of your business system. Therefore, certain integrations, applications, and workflow automations can present unforeseen difficulties. 

Native integrations empower you to do more and give you untethered control over your business operations. 

Scalability 

Using native integrations can give you a competitive advantage in your industry. 

If your sales team is struggling to keep out with a hefty load of sales and invoicing, for example, you’re not alone. Other businesses are facing the same setbacks. 

Except, if you make use of native integrations, you can set up some sales automation tools and leave those other businesses squirming in the dust. 

Although the picture isn’t pleasant, the big picture is clear. And that’s just one example of what native integration can do for you. 

Disadvantages of Native Integration

Native integration probably sounds too good to be true. But like any innovation, there’s a pros and cons list to level out the playing field. Here are the cons. 

Efficiency 

Though scalability is the ultimate goal of using native integration, there are some nuances. For instance, native integration is a more complicated process than relying on some popular iPaaS consumer app. 

Indeed, the whole point is to reap the benefits of more customization. But to devote so much effort to a project for every system you need to integrate is a reality you would be wise to consider. 

First of all, these efforts would be markedly resource-intensive. You may need to hire developers or augment your IT staff just to make ends meet. Not to mention, there are technical resources that you should account for as well. 

You won’t regret the outcome, but the building and maintenance of native integration projects are a great deal of labor. Customizability might come at the expense of efficiency. 

Affordability 

When complexity is the name of the game, costly is the price tag. Simply put, the more complex or custom an integration is, the higher the cost will be

While quoting numbers is futile here, keep in mind that ‘you need to spend money to make money’ rings true in this scenario. 

Like with any product, you will want to carefully take note of your budget and resources. Research your options where applicable. 

There are a couple of standout enterprises, for instance, that can create custom integrations for you and are specifically geared towards small businesses. 

How Trio Can Help You Meet Your Integration Needs

Trio extends qualified software engineers to businesses in need and applies care and professional support to the issues they have. 

Of course, data integration is a frequent concern of many businesses that may not have the IT team to truly focus on scaling upwards. 

Ergo, native integration is one of Trio’s top priorities. Trio engineers are trained and specialized to think critically about the problems you’re facing and build direct solutions to solve them. 

To talk more about native integrations and their role in your business, reach out to Trio today!

 

Cordenne Brewster

Content Writer

About

A tech enthusiast whose ardor is best expressed through the written word.

Frequently Asked Questions

If you’re looking for some information, but can’t find it here, please contact us.

Go to FAQ Arrow Left

Data integration involves syncing business systems together for more efficient management.

Native integration refers to a means of integrating software applications or platforms with one another using application programming interfaces (APIs).

APIs are back-end structures of code that ensure that distinct software systems can interact.